Transaction 507a756bc1faaf4bc492966114c0005957ea8a31df0305a1f60a13f4eb096ade
1 Input
1 Output
-
507a756bc1faaf4bc492966114c0005957ea8a31df0305a1f60a13f4eb096ade:0
- value
- 741809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1a6716167b96663118bcd141b484891c1961f27 OP_EQUAL
- address
- 3KLwjDprquZSgdCS8Hgehz6jtjjbcu7unW